Seguridad de contratos inteligentes para principiantes y puentes entre cadenas en la capa 2 de Bitco
Seguridad de contratos inteligentes para principiantes
En el cambiante mundo de la tecnología blockchain, los contratos inteligentes desempeñan un papel indispensable. Actúan como contratos autoejecutables, cuyos términos se escriben directamente en el código. Esta innovación ha revolucionado diversos sectores, desde las finanzas hasta la gestión de la cadena de suministro, ofreciendo niveles de automatización y eficiencia sin precedentes. Sin embargo, a medida que los contratos inteligentes crecen en complejidad y adopción, también crece la necesidad de contar con medidas de seguridad robustas.
Entendiendo los contratos inteligentes
En esencia, los contratos inteligentes son fragmentos de código almacenados en una cadena de bloques que ejecutan automáticamente acciones predefinidas cuando se cumplen ciertas condiciones. Esta automatización elimina la necesidad de intermediarios, lo que reduce costos y aumenta la confianza. Las soluciones de capa 2 de Bitcoin mejoran este concepto al proporcionar escalabilidad y tiempos de transacción más rápidos sin comprometer la seguridad.
Seguridad en los contratos inteligentes
Dada su importancia crítica, los contratos inteligentes son objetivos prioritarios para actores maliciosos. Una falla en un contrato inteligente puede ocasionar pérdidas financieras significativas, por lo que la seguridad es fundamental. A continuación, se presentan algunos aspectos fundamentales de la seguridad de los contratos inteligentes:
Auditorías de Código: Las auditorías periódicas y exhaustivas del código de los contratos inteligentes realizadas por expertos en seguridad son cruciales. Estas auditorías ayudan a identificar vulnerabilidades antes de la implementación de los contratos. Las revisiones entre pares de desarrolladores también contribuyen a descubrir posibles debilidades.
Pruebas: Es fundamental realizar pruebas exhaustivas, incluyendo pruebas unitarias, de integración e incluso pruebas fuzz. Las pruebas garantizan que los contratos inteligentes funcionen según lo previsto en diversos escenarios, detectando errores que podrían explotarse.
Verificación formal: Esto implica demostrar matemáticamente que el contrato inteligente se comportará según lo previsto en todas las circunstancias. Si bien es más compleja y requiere muchos recursos, la verificación formal puede proporcionar una capa adicional de seguridad.
Programas de recompensas por errores: Las plataformas pueden establecer programas de recompensas por errores para incentivar a los hackers éticos a encontrar y reportar vulnerabilidades. Este enfoque comunitario puede descubrir problemas de seguridad que, de otro modo, podrían pasar desapercibidos.
Mejores prácticas para desarrolladores de contratos inteligentes
Para reforzar la seguridad de los contratos inteligentes, los desarrolladores pueden seguir varias prácticas recomendadas:
Mantenlo simple: Cuanto más simple sea el código, menos vulnerabilidades habrá. Busca el minimalismo en el diseño y la funcionalidad.
Utilice bibliotecas probadas: Aproveche bibliotecas ampliamente utilizadas y bien verificadas para funcionalidades comunes. Estas bibliotecas suelen ser sometidas a un escrutinio exhaustivo y es menos probable que contengan fallos ocultos.
Implementar controles de acceso: restringir el acceso a funciones y datos confidenciales dentro del contrato inteligente para evitar modificaciones no autorizadas.
Manténgase actualizado: La tecnología blockchain está en constante evolución. Mantenerse al día con los últimos parches y actualizaciones de seguridad es crucial para mantener una defensa robusta.
Tendencias emergentes en la seguridad de los contratos inteligentes
De cara al año 2026, varias tendencias están dando forma al futuro de la seguridad de los contratos inteligentes:
Verificación de identidad descentralizada: la implementación de soluciones de identidad descentralizada puede mejorar la seguridad al garantizar que solo los usuarios autenticados puedan ejecutar ciertas funciones dentro de un contrato inteligente.
Carteras multifirma: requerir múltiples firmas para ejecutar transacciones de alto valor agrega una capa adicional de seguridad, lo que hace más difícil que un solo actor comprometa el contrato.
Técnicas de cifrado avanzadas: el uso de métodos de cifrado de última generación puede proteger datos confidenciales dentro de contratos inteligentes, garantizando la confidencialidad y la integridad.
Conclusión
La seguridad de los contratos inteligentes es un campo dinámico que exige vigilancia e innovación constantes. Al adherirse a las mejores prácticas y aprovechar las tecnologías emergentes, los desarrolladores pueden crear contratos inteligentes más seguros y confiables. Conforme nos acercamos a 2026, la fusión de medidas de seguridad avanzadas con la escalabilidad y eficiencia de las soluciones de capa 2 de Bitcoin promete abrir nuevas fronteras en las finanzas descentralizadas y más allá.
Explorando puentes entre cadenas en la capa 2 de Bitcoin
Los puentes entre cadenas son fundamentales en el ecosistema blockchain, ya que permiten la transferencia de activos y datos entre diferentes redes. A medida que la tecnología blockchain se diversifica, la capacidad de interactuar fluidamente entre diversas cadenas cobra cada vez mayor importancia. En esta sección, profundizamos en el concepto de puentes entre cadenas y su potencial en las soluciones de capa 2 de Bitcoin para 2026.
¿Qué son los puentes entre cadenas?
Los puentes entre cadenas facilitan la comunicación y el intercambio de datos entre diferentes redes blockchain. Permiten a los usuarios transferir activos de una blockchain a otra, garantizando así la interoperabilidad. Esta capacidad es crucial para crear una red verdaderamente descentralizada donde diferentes blockchains puedan coexistir e interactuar armoniosamente.
Cómo funcionan los puentes entre cadenas
Los puentes entre cadenas generalmente implican algunos componentes clave:
Oráculos: Son servicios confiables de terceros que verifican datos fuera de la cadena para contratos inteligentes dentro de la cadena. Los oráculos desempeñan un papel fundamental para garantizar la precisión y la seguridad de los datos que se transfieren entre cadenas.
Contratos inteligentes: Se utilizan para bloquear activos en una cadena y generar activos equivalentes en otra. Gestionan la compleja logística de la transferencia de activos y garantizan la preservación del valor.
Protocolos de comunicación entre cadenas de bloques: Protocolos como Polkadot y Cosmos facilitan una comunicación segura y eficiente entre diferentes cadenas de bloques. Estos protocolos sustentan la funcionalidad de los puentes entre cadenas.
Beneficios de los puentes entre cadenas
Los puentes entre cadenas ofrecen numerosos beneficios:
Interoperabilidad: Permiten que diferentes cadenas de bloques trabajen juntas, desbloqueando nuevos casos de uso y aplicaciones.
Liquidez: Al permitir que los activos se muevan entre cadenas, aumentan la liquidez y brindan a los usuarios más opciones de inversión y comercio.
Escalabilidad: Los puentes entre cadenas pueden ayudar a mitigar los problemas de escalabilidad de las cadenas de bloques individuales al distribuir activos y transacciones entre múltiples cadenas.
Puentes entre cadenas en la capa 2 de Bitcoin
Las soluciones de capa 2 de Bitcoin, como Lightning Network, buscan abordar los problemas de escalabilidad de Bitcoin al trasladar las transacciones fuera de la cadena de bloques principal. La integración de puentes entre cadenas en la capa 2 de Bitcoin puede mejorar aún más sus capacidades:
Escalabilidad mejorada: al permitir que las transacciones ocurran en la Capa 2 mientras se siguen beneficiando de la seguridad y confianza de la cadena de bloques de Bitcoin, los puentes entre cadenas pueden aumentar significativamente el rendimiento de las transacciones.
Costos reducidos: Las soluciones de capa 2 ya reducen las comisiones por transacción. Los puentes entre cadenas pueden reducir aún más los costos al facilitar transferencias de activos más económicas entre diferentes cadenas de bloques.
Mayor adopción: la capacidad de interactuar sin problemas con otras cadenas de bloques puede atraer a más desarrolladores y usuarios al ecosistema de Bitcoin, impulsando una adopción más amplia.
Desafíos y soluciones
A pesar de su potencial, los puentes entre cadenas enfrentan varios desafíos:
Riesgos de seguridad: Los puentes pueden convertirse en objetivos de ataques, ya que representan un único punto de falla entre cadenas. Las soluciones incluyen sistemas de oráculo robustos y billeteras multifirma para mejorar la seguridad.
Complejidad: Gestionar activos en múltiples cadenas puede ser complejo. Las soluciones incluyen el desarrollo de interfaces intuitivas y herramientas automatizadas para simplificar el proceso.
Obstáculos regulatorios: Las transacciones transfronterizas suelen estar sujetas al escrutinio regulatorio. Colaborar con expertos legales y adoptar soluciones que cumplan con las normativas puede ayudar a superar estos desafíos.
Tendencias emergentes en puentes entre cadenas
Se espera que para 2026, varias tendencias definan el panorama de los puentes entre cadenas:
Organizaciones Autónomas Descentralizadas (DAO): Las DAO pueden desempeñar un papel en la gestión y financiación de puentes entre cadenas, garantizando que sean sostenibles y adaptables a las necesidades cambiantes.
Protocolos de interoperabilidad: Se espera que protocolos avanzados como Polkadot y Cosmos evolucionen, ofreciendo una comunicación entre cadenas más eficiente y segura.
Integración de soluciones de capa 2: a medida que las soluciones de capa 2 maduren, su integración con puentes entre cadenas será más fluida y ofrecerá transacciones más rápidas y económicas.
Conclusión
Los puentes entre cadenas revolucionarán el mundo blockchain al permitir la interoperabilidad entre diferentes redes. En la capa 2 de Bitcoin, su integración promete alcanzar nuevos niveles de escalabilidad, rentabilidad y adopción por parte de los usuarios. De cara al 2026, la continua evolución de estos puentes, junto con sólidas medidas de seguridad, allanará el camino hacia un ecosistema blockchain más interconectado y dinámico. Al adoptar estas innovaciones, podemos anticipar un futuro donde la tecnología blockchain realmente cumpla su promesa de descentralización y conectividad universal.
En un mundo cada vez más centrado en la sostenibilidad, la tecnología de registro distribuido (DLT) se erige como un faro de esperanza en la lucha contra el cambio climático y la búsqueda de la inclusión financiera. Esta innovadora tecnología, que sustenta la cadena de bloques, no solo está transformando industrias, sino que también desempeña un papel fundamental en el esfuerzo global por alcanzar cero emisiones netas de carbono para 2026.
Comprensión de la tecnología de contabilidad distribuida
En esencia, la DLT es un libro de contabilidad digital descentralizado que registra transacciones en múltiples computadoras, de modo que el registro no pueda modificarse retroactivamente. Esta tecnología garantiza la transparencia, la seguridad y la eficiencia de las transacciones, lo que la convierte en una herramienta poderosa para diversas aplicaciones más allá de las criptomonedas.
Para principiantes, piensen en la DLT como un cuaderno digital compartido que cualquiera puede ver, pero que nadie puede modificar una vez realizada una entrada. Esto difiere de los libros de contabilidad tradicionales, donde una autoridad central controla los datos. En la DLT, cada participante de la red tiene una copia del libro de contabilidad, lo que lo hace altamente resistente al fraude y la manipulación.
El papel de la DLT en la inclusión financiera
La inclusión financiera es el proceso de garantizar que las personas y las empresas tengan acceso a productos y servicios financieros útiles y asequibles que satisfagan sus necesidades (transacciones, pagos, ahorros, crédito y seguros), con una prestación justa y eficiente. La tecnología DLT es revolucionaria en este ámbito, ya que ofrece igualdad de condiciones para todos, independientemente de su ubicación geográfica o situación económica.
Los sistemas bancarios tradicionales suelen excluir a las poblaciones no bancarizadas o con acceso limitado a servicios bancarios debido a los altos costos, la falta de sucursales físicas y la complejidad del papeleo. La tecnología DLT, con sus comisiones de transacción mínimas y la ausencia de intermediarios, puede reducir estas barreras. Por ejemplo, los microcréditos facilitados mediante blockchain pueden empoderar a las pequeñas empresas en zonas remotas, impulsando el crecimiento económico y reduciendo la pobreza.
Iniciativas de cero emisiones netas sostenibles y DLT
El concepto de cero emisiones netas para 2026 es fundamental en el esfuerzo global por mitigar los impactos adversos del cambio climático. Cero emisiones netas significa equilibrar las emisiones de gases de efecto invernadero con su absorción equivalente de la atmósfera. Lograrlo requiere soluciones innovadoras en todos los sectores.
La tecnología DLT ofrece una forma transparente y eficiente de rastrear los créditos de carbono y la reducción de emisiones. Imagine un mercado global donde las empresas puedan comprar y vender créditos de carbono de forma transparente, segura y eficiente. La tecnología DLT puede proporcionar la infraestructura para dicho mercado, garantizando que cada transacción se registre y verifique, fomentando así la confianza y la rendición de cuentas.
Además, la tecnología de distribución distribuida (DLT) puede impulsar prácticas sostenibles al permitir cadenas de suministro más inteligentes y eficientes. Por ejemplo, al rastrear el recorrido de un producto desde la materia prima hasta el producto terminado, la DLT puede ayudar a garantizar que cada paso de la cadena de suministro se adhiera a prácticas sostenibles, reduciendo así los residuos y las emisiones.
La sinergia de la DLT, la inclusión financiera y el cero neto
La sinergia entre la DLT, la inclusión financiera y las iniciativas sostenibles de cero emisiones netas es poderosa. Al proporcionar una plataforma para la inclusión financiera, la DLT puede empoderar a las comunidades desatendidas para que participen en la economía global y contribuyan al desarrollo sostenible. Al mismo tiempo, su transparencia y eficiencia facilitan el seguimiento y la gestión de las emisiones de carbono, contribuyendo así al logro de los objetivos de cero emisiones netas.
Por ejemplo, considere un escenario en el que un país en desarrollo utiliza DLT para rastrear y comercializar créditos de carbono. Esto no solo ayuda al país a alcanzar sus objetivos de cero emisiones netas, sino que también genera un flujo de ingresos que puede reinvertirse en infraestructura local, educación y atención médica, impulsando así la inclusión financiera y el desarrollo sostenible.
En conclusión, la intersección de la tecnología de registro distribuido (DLT), la inclusión financiera y las iniciativas sostenibles de cero emisiones netas presenta una narrativa convincente de cómo la tecnología puede impulsar un cambio positivo a escala global. A medida que nos acercamos a 2026, el papel de la DLT en este proceso transformador probablemente se acentuará aún más, ofreciendo nuevas oportunidades y soluciones a algunos de los desafíos más urgentes de nuestro tiempo.
Manténgase atento a la Parte 2, donde profundizaremos en ejemplos específicos y estudios de casos que muestran el impacto de la DLT en la inclusión financiera y las iniciativas sostenibles de cero emisiones netas.
Cultivo continuo de puntos para recompensas de blockchain Desbloqueando el futuro de las recompensas
Desbloqueando el futuro navegando por las cambiantes mareas de las oportunidades financieras de bloc